MGI Phenotype |
F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] The protein encoded by this gene is a positive regulator of the Wnt signaling pathway. The encoded protein is found associated with gamma tubulin at the centrosome. Alternative splicing results in multiple transcript variants encoding different isoforms. [provided by RefSeq, Jun 2013] PHENOTYPE: Mice homozygous for a knock-out allele exhibit reduced spontaneous locomotor activity, abnormal behavior in the elevated plus maze, and deficits in startle reactivity. [provided by MGI curators]
